The rebalancing tool assigns van routes every 15 minutes from dock-fullness telemetry. If the dispatch queue stalls, routes go stale and docks in the Harrowgate zone overflow first. Check the `route-planner` worker logs for solver timeouts; anything over 90 seconds means the constraint set is too large, usually from a stale geofence import. Reviewers should confirm any geofence change includes a solver benchmark run. The stall-recovery procedure and benchmark harness are documented on the internal page.

runbook for badug-kadup: https://confluence.zemvarlabs.internal/projects/browse/display/projects/bd1b

Re: `docstyle/rules.py` — the Quibblecheck linter now fires on every heading-depth violation, which is noisy during incident writeups. Suggest demoting that rule to a warning and capping reported findings per file so on-call doesn't drown in output when linting legacy docs under `runbooks/`. Everything else looks fine. For reference, the thresholds this module currently enforces are these.

tuning constants:
QUOTAS = {
    "druwyn": 5,
    "holix": 5,
    "zorath": 5,
    "holwyn": 10,
}

## DiffHaven Changelog — 2.9.0

Renamed `BIGFILE_MODE` to `LARGE_DIFF_STRATEGY` for clarity; accepted values are unchanged (`chunked`, `mmap`). Reviewers: flag any PRs still referencing the old key. The env file ordering now matters for our config linter — the strategy key comes first, and the artifact-store credential must appear on the line right after it.

vault entry, yahif-yajep: COURIER_KEY29=b802bdf8034096b65a51c6ba5abe2

## Deploying the Gatewick Proctor Queue

Deploys are pretty painless: push to main, wait for the pipeline, then watch the queue drain dashboard for five minutes. If candidates pile up mid-exam, roll back first and ask questions later — the queue replays safely. Everything the workers care about lives in one config block, shown here for reference.

settings of bafof-yagef:
JOROX_PIN=8740
JOROX_TENANT=pelox
JOROX_METRICS_HOST=metrics.jorox.qorvelworks.internal
JOROX_SEAL=seal_c78f63c1
JOROX_STANDBY_TEAM=norax